Understanding Peoria Motorcycle Accident Laws
In Peoria, motorcycle accidents can result in severe injuries and significant financial burdens for riders. Understanding the local laws regarding motorcycle accident lawsuits is crucial for victims seeking compensation. The state of Illinois has specific regulations that protect motorcyclists’ rights, ensuring fair treatment after a crash.
Peoria’s motorcycle accident laws emphasize the importance of driver negligence and liability. If a motorist’s actions, such as speeding, reckless driving, or failure to yield, lead to a collision with a motorcycle, they may be held accountable. Victims can file a lawsuit against the at-fault driver to recover dam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. Building a Strong Case for Compensation
Building a strong case for compensation in a Peoria motorcycle accident lawsuit requires thorough preparation and a deep understanding of legal procedures. The first step is to gather all relevant evidence, including medical records, police reports, and witness statements. This documentation serves as the backbone of your claim, proving the severity of injuries and the circumstances surrounding the accident.
Additionally, it’s crucial to establish liability by demonstrating that another party, such as a negligent driver or a faulty vehicle part manufacturer, is responsible for the incident. Experienced legal counsel can help navigate complex insurance policies and state laws to ensure you receive f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and any other associated damages.
